Alan Dretel Obituary

Alan Mark Dretel
Alan Mark Dretel, 68, of Sherman, CT, and Southern Pines, NC, passed peacefully, at his home, on Sunday, March 9, 2025, with his wife, Rhonda Lynn Dretel (nee Nursey), at his side.
Born in New Brunswick, NJ, Sept. 4, 1956, he was the son of the late Martin and Frieda Reiter Dretel. Alan grew up in Danbury, CT and worked for his father's business as a young man. After his high school graduation, he took on a more permanent role with the family business, D & S Pump and Supply, taking it over in the early 1980s. As the business grew, it expanded to have locations ranging from Maine to eastern Tennessee.
Alan was a hardworking and dedicated man, standing up for his beliefs, but his family and those that knew him saw his caring and soft side. He and Rhonda enjoyed riding their horses. It was this love that brought them from Connecticut to Southern Pines, where they quickly become active in the equestrian community, with Alan serving on the board of the Walthour Moss Foundation for many years.
Alan earned his pilot's license, including a commercial rating, in the early 1990s, allowing him to visit the multiple locations of his company and customers more easily.
Alan is survived by his wife, Rhonda Dretel. He was the father of David Joel Dretel and Aaron Mark Dretel, wife Carrie Dretel and the grandfather of Hunter, Jake, Luke, Emmitt, Shilo, Gideon, Felicity and Cilas. Alan was the brother of Donna Kozlowski and the late David Dretel.
